Suzano Signed An Agreement With Chinese Company For The Construction Of Ships. 17 Vessels Will Be Built Focusing On Cellulose Transport.
During the business meetings held by the Brazilian mission in China, Suzano signed an agreement with the Chinese shipping company Cosco for the construction of 17 cellulose transport ships and other biological base products. According to reports, the company involved in shipbuilding also includes a long-term transportation contract, according to a document from the Brazilian mission delivered to journalists accompanying the event with businesspeople from both countries.

Reuters reports that Suzano, the largest eucalyptus pulp producer in the world, which has China as one of its main markets, besides the shipbuilding, also signed a memorandum of understanding with China Paper Company for a partnership in biological base materials and carbon, as well as investments in research and development. The values of the agreements and other information were not disclosed.
It is worth mentioning that, in the fourth quarter of 2022, Suzano reported a profit of R$ 7.459 billion, an increase of 222% compared to the same period the previous year. According to the report, adjusted EBITDA reached R$ 8.175 billion in the period, an increase of 29% when considering the same period of the previous year.

The net revenue for the previously mentioned period totaled R$ 14.370 billion, an increase of 25% over the fourth quarter of 2021, and the leverage in reais was 2.5x in 4Q22, compared to 2.2x in 3Q22.
Suzano Launches Hub in China
In addition to the new agreement for shipbuilding, Suzano inaugurated its Innovation Hub in China on the 21st of this month. The event was attended by customers, government representatives, members of the Academy, and other stakeholders.
The facility, located in ZhangJiang Science City in Shanghai, aims to address the growing demand from customers for applications and materials developed through cellulose and new biomaterials.
The Hub will also serve as a partnership base for various participants in the field and other stakeholders in China and abroad to drive sustainable progress through innovation. China, due to its transition goals for a cleaner economy, has demonstrated an accelerated transition from high-speed expansion to high-quality growth, which has been made possible by its extensive experience in R&D and innovation gained over the past decades.
Suzano Paper and Pulp Also Invests in Brazil
Also this month, Suzano announced the installation of a new factory that will operate in cellulose production, aiming to create the largest production line of the material in a single scale in the world, as previously reported by Correio do Estado. The project will receive a total investment of R$ 14.7 billion, in addition to generating 13,000 jobs throughout the construction and operation process of the factory in MS.
Located in Ribas do Rio Pardo, the new facility will have the capacity to produce 2.3 million tons of eucalyptus pulp per year. The company plans to begin production at the new unit, which promises to create thousands of jobs, by the end of the first quarter of 2024, a project that has been named Project Cerrado, due to its location in MS.
